A Thermoelectric Waste-Heat-Recovery System for Portland Cement Rotary
The cement rotary kiln is the crucial equipment used for cement production. Approximately 10–15% of the energy consumed in production of the cement clinker is directly dissipated into the atmosphere through the external surface of the rotary kiln. Innovative technology for energy conservation is urgently needed by the cement industry.

Modeling and pilot plant runs of slow biomass pyrolysis in a rotary kiln
For example, Sanginés et al. [12] studied the slow pyrolysis of olive stones in a batch type rotary kiln. Among various characteristics, the study found that the gentle mixing in the rotary kiln smoothens the char particle surfaces which makes them more round and which eventually enhances their flowability in downstream processes.

Sintering conditions recognition of rotary kiln based on …
The sintering condition of the rotary kiln directly influences the clinker quality. Taking the alumina rotary kiln as an example, there are three main sintering conditions in kilns: normal, super-chilled and super-heated. Super-chilled and super-heated conditions are abnormal conditions.
